MRC Lets Megyn Kelly Deny Fox News’ Bias

Posted on April 7, 2016

Curtis Houck writes in an April 3 MRC NewsBusters post:

Megyn Kelly sat down for her latest interview with CBS/PBS host Charlie Rose and in one portion that aired on CBS News Sunday Morning, The Kelly File host rejected Rose’s belief that there’s “a right-wing bias” at Fox News and not a liberal bias across the larger news media.

After playing some clips from her early years at the Fox News Channel (FNC), Rose pointed out that not only is she someone who “doesn’t hold back,” but she has been “equally aggressive in her defense of Fox News.”

Kelly responded that she does, however, “believe that there is a left leaning bias in news, in most of news” and in turn Rose put forth the belief among the liberal media that they’re not bias but it’s Fox who has an agenda.

She then firmly shot back: “No I don’t. I think Fox News is far and balanced. The conservatives who are on air here make no bones about their ideology.”

When Rose pressed her on whether or not many at FNC have a “closer relationship with Donald Trump,” Kelly did not dispute it seeing as how he’s “on our air every day.”

Since this is the Media Research Center we’re talking about, it’s not going to point out that Kelly is actually telling a falsehood when she claims Fox News is “fair and balanced”; it is not, and neither is she. But that’s to be expected — MRC officials would like to continue appearing on Fox News, after all (including on Kelly’s show).

But Houck rather dishonestly whitewashes Rose’s question to Kelly about whether “many at FNC have a .closer relationship with Donald Trump.'”In fact, as the transcript attached to Houck’s post shows, Rose’s actual question was, “But does Fox News have closer relationship with Donald Trump, with the Republican Party than it does with liberals and Democratic Party?”

In other words, Rose highlighted Fox’s close Republican ties, and it’s not clear that Kelly’s response was limited only to Trump, as Houck insinuates.

We know that the MRC is in bed with Fox, presumably to keep that sweet airtime flowing its way. But at least tell the truth, guys.
